In addition to this positive result there is also the bonus on operational performance
as provided by the current community regulations for the excellent operational
management that ENAV, continuing from the past, has confirmed during the year
that has just ended. In particular, regarding en-route services, it should be noted
that against a capacity target of 0.09 minutes/flight, the result was 0.0095 minutes/
flight. Following the achievement of such performance, it was possible to book a 5.5
million Euro bonus in the Income Statement. Considering also that the Performance
Plan included a terminal services performance target linked to capacity for systems
in the first and second charge bands, the overall 2015 bonus linked to the efficiency
of en-route and terminal services provided by ENAV using its own systems, was for
an overall amount of approximately 6 million Euros.
In this context, the positive performance achieved by the Company in 2015 has
made it possible to mitigate the effect of a reduction in traffic during the year of
-4.5%, with respect to the value entered in the Performance Plan in terms of en-
route service units, that have been recovered only in part from the market by means
of price regulation, and achieving a result of 49.8 million Euros, one of the best
results achieved by the Company in these last few years.
